Businesses want to know how their products will perform in climatic conditions elsewhere in the world. In this way, it finds the opportunity to market its products all over the world. In order to make these tests accurate and reliable, there is a need for climatic test rooms designed by utilizing technological facilities. In these test rooms, high temperature and humidity sensitivity can be prepared according to the product properties to be tested. In this way, the products are tested under different climatic conditions. In the climatic test rooms, the temperature sensitivity of minus 0,1 and humidity of up to 1 can be provided as required.

In particular, companies producing large white goods have the opportunity to test a wide range of products from air conditioners to refrigerators, water dispensers and washing machines under various climatic conditions in these climatic test rooms. Thanks to these tests, it is determined whether the products work in the climatic conditions and how much energy they consume.

The climatic test chambers within the test and inspection organizations are capable of carrying out climate conditions tests of the products in the low temperature group between minus 50 and plus 80 degrees and in the high temperature group between 80 and 250 degrees. In addition, relative humidity conditions can be created between 10 and 100. Thanks to the variable fan speeds, the desired climatic conditions are created exactly. Climatic test rooms are fully managed by computer control.

During the specific test studies, the current regulations and the relevant standards published by many domestic and foreign organizations are taken into consideration.
